 The
 position will manage women's health care, focusing particularly on pregnancy, childbirth, the
 postpartum period, care of the newborn, and the family planning and gynecologic
 needs of women. The position will practice within the health
 care system and perform consultation, collaborative management, or referral, as
 indicated by the health status of the client. The position will practice in accord with the Standards for the Practice
 of Midwifery, as defined by the American College of Nurse-Midwives. The candidate hired will be expected to
 participate in the education and training of student nurse midwives and other
 advanced practice providers, medical students, residents, and fellows in the
 clinical setting. Classroom education of
